我來試試吧。”
蕭雲飛的聲音並不響亮,但是卻透著一種自信和堅定。
圍觀的學生看到說話的蕭雲飛,紛紛替他讓出一條道,心中暗自竊喜,剛才羅傑斯教授的眼神和語氣令他們這些天之驕子無地自容,此時看到又有人出來挑戰,他們自然對蕭雲飛表現出了極大的熱情。
羅傑斯看著蕭雲飛笑了笑:“小夥子,你確定要挑戰我的擂台?”
蕭雲飛看著羅傑斯教授藍色的眼睛,堅定的點了點頭。
羅傑斯聳了聳肩攤開雙手:“好吧,你的精神令我很佩服,不過我希望你設計出來的程序能夠健壯一點,不然這個遊戲就不好玩了。”
蕭雲飛笑了笑沒有說話,徑直走到一台計算機麵前坐了下來,然後,他開始編寫程序了。
蕭雲飛編寫程序的速度很快,雙手好像在鍵盤上舞蹈一樣,動作行雲流水,中間根本就沒有一絲停頓的跡象,因為在觀戰的時候,蕭雲飛針對羅傑斯教授的程序在內存單元中的表現,已經在腦海中的設計好了每一條程序指令。
薛亞妮看著蕭雲飛一臉專注的表情,臉上不由得閃過一絲好奇的笑意,看他編寫程序的樣子,似乎真的不簡單呢。
蕭雲飛在程序中采用了“混沌加密”加密了一段關於對某一特定模塊集中轟炸的指令,同時,程序中還加密**了一個中斷程序。
國際上地加密算法多種多樣。一個人不可能對每種加密算法都了如指掌。所以蕭雲飛運用“混沌加密”地算法加密匯編程序。其他人也並未覺得奇怪。
蕭雲飛用了五分鍾就編好了這個程序。然後他站起身衝羅傑斯教授說道:“教授。我地程序已經編寫好了。我們可以開始比賽了嗎?”
羅傑斯看了看蕭雲飛。有點擔憂地問道:“小夥子。你不再檢查檢查?雖然我地擂台是一個遊戲。但是我也不希望你如此輕視對待。”
蕭雲飛擺了擺手:“教授。正是因為我重視他。所以我才用最精短地程序來向您挑戰。”
蕭雲飛頓了頓接著說道:“程序地作戰能力並不取決代碼數量地多少。它在於自保、攻擊和修複地能力。這些東西完全是從算法地層麵上考慮。我地程序。相信已經把這些功能揮得淋漓盡致了。”
羅傑斯教授“哼”了一聲。似乎很不滿意蕭雲飛地說辭。他覺得蕭雲飛就是在輕視他。
“你的程序再好,能敵得過我的智能程序?”羅傑斯教授恨恨的問道。
蕭雲飛笑了笑:“或許您地程序根本就揮不了作用呢。”
羅傑斯教授差點被蕭雲飛氣死:“啊!待會我一定要打得你這個狂妄的小子滿地找牙!”
“既然這樣,那我們何不馬上開始呢?”
“好!我要讓你見識見識我的厲害。”羅傑斯教授有點孩子氣的坐到計算機前,衝蕭雲飛如是說道。
兩個人地程序先被保存在虛擬係統的存儲磁芯,然後程序開始加載,就在係統要給程序在進程隊列中創建進程地時候,蕭雲飛的中斷程序被觸,然後中斷程序開始運行。
這個中斷程序的作用就是禁止係統創建進程,無法創建進程,羅傑斯教授的程序就根本不能進行內存遍曆,連內存遍曆都不能進行,如何對蕭雲飛的程序進行轟炸?
打個比方,如果秦始皇在朱姬肚子裏的時候就被幹掉了,縱然他有刀槍不入,水火不侵,三頭六臂,神功蓋世,英武不凡,氣宇軒昂,人見人愛,花見花開,車胎見了要爆胎地本事,他也不可能一統六國,成為天下霸主。
當然,我們要排除《尋秦記》中找人冒充嬴政的橋段。
(pss:形容詞我本來打算還多用幾個地,但是我怕各位讀大大打我的臉,所以還是算了,畢竟我是靠臉混飯吃滴……)
所以,蕭雲飛地目的就是要把羅傑斯地程序扼殺在搖籃裏,不給它機會跳出存儲磁芯!
羅傑斯教授望了望計算機屏幕,然後側過頭來看著蕭雲飛問道:“你動了什麽手腳?為什麽係統沒有為我們兩人的程序分配進程?”
“嗬嗬,”蕭雲飛撓了撓頭不好意思的笑了笑,“教授,你的程序這麽厲害,我當然不能讓它進入到內存單元中去,所以我的中斷程序將係統創建進程的功能鎖定了。”
“啊?”羅傑斯教授的眼睛瞪得老大,“我們的程序對戰,你就應該讓它們跳進內存單元轟轟烈烈的廝殺一番,想不到你竟然用這一招!”
“可是教授,您並沒有規定隻能進行程序間的對抗啊,我當然可以另辟蹊徑。”蕭雲飛有點無辜的攤開雙手。
試想,如果你要正麵入侵一個指
站,而這個網站的安保性能非常強大,你會怎麽做?
相信很多人都會采用旁注這種辦法。先,入侵這個網站服務器下其他安全性較為薄弱的網站;然後,通過這個被入侵的網站想辦法得到服務器的控製權限;最後,利用服務器的控製權限黑掉這個指定的網站。
這個步驟被人戲稱為“黑站三部曲”。
蕭雲飛的辦法其實與“旁注”有異曲同工之妙,為什麽這麽說?他並沒有從羅傑斯的程序上入手,相反,他采用的是從程序運行的係統上下手,讓程序喪失運行的條件。
黑客,要具有散的思維,可不能一條道走到底啊!
羅傑斯被蕭雲飛說得啞口無言,其他圍觀也露出若有所思的表情。
“小夥子,既然你禁止了係統分配進程,那麽我們兩人的程序都不能進入到內存單元,所以,進程隊列中不會出現我的程序,但是同樣也不會出現你的程序,我們也算是個平局,你也並沒有打擂成功哦……”羅傑斯教授看著蕭雲飛,臉上帶著狡猾的笑意。
蕭雲飛笑了笑,露出一副果然如此的表情:“我早知道教授您會這麽說,不過別著急,好戲還在後頭呢。”
係統分配進程的功能雖然被中斷程序禁用了,這就相當於程序被掛起,根本就不可能執行,但是蕭雲飛的模塊集中轟炸指令卻並未受到束縛,在羅傑斯教授和蕭雲飛交談的過程中,它已經尋找到了固定在存儲磁芯的程序。
係統不能為程序分配進程,但是程序此時依然是保存在係統的存儲磁芯中的,雖然這個存儲磁芯的地址是一個範圍,但是這個範圍是不會改變的。
蕭雲飛的模塊集中轟炸指令的功能就是針對這個固定範圍的存儲磁芯地址進行地毯式轟炸!
羅傑斯看到自己的程序在存儲磁芯中被蕭雲飛的程序轟炸,臉上露出一副不可置信的表情,周圍的學生更是一片嘩然。
到目前為止,根本就沒有人見過能夠在存儲磁芯中進行轟炸功能的程序!
羅傑斯教授的程序雖然具有一定的智能性,但是這種智能性要取決於它生存的環境,比如在內存單元中,他的程序可不是那麽容易被幹掉的。
但是現在的情況不一樣,羅傑斯教授的程序在存儲磁芯中就像被施了定身咒,麵對模塊集中轟炸指令,它根本就沒有一點反應。
可憐這個帶有一定智能性的程序就被當成靶子被轟炸得屍骨無存了。
轟炸指令完成它的使命後自動執行了一條毀滅自己的指令,這個指令和大名鼎鼎的“收割”(reaper)程序的自毀指令是一樣的。
(pss:“收割”程序就是對“爬行”程序進行攻擊,其實田中仲才的程序裂變與“爬行”的行為很類似,通過瘋狂繁衍副本來擠掉電腦中的原有資料,“收割”的目的就是要毀滅掉這些副本)
這些自毀指令通常都是有目的性的,比如“收割”程序的自毀是為了還原電腦幹淨的空間,蕭雲飛的程序轟炸指令的自毀,目的就是向程序本體傳遞一個信息。
董存瑞炸碉堡時候喊的口號是:“同誌們,為了新中國,衝啊!”
轟炸指令的自毀,傳遞的信息其實和英雄的意思差不多,那就是在告訴程序本體:“哥們,我已經把敵人消滅了,臨死之前我放了信號彈,後麵的打、砸、搶、燒等暴力活動就交給你們啦……”
董存瑞的戰友們聽到這句鼓舞人心的話,吹著激昂的衝鋒號,雄赳氣昂昂,順利地攻占了敵人的堡壘。
程序收到轟炸指令的自毀信息,立馬解除了中斷程序,係統分配進程的禁令解除,然後開始為蕭雲飛的程序分配進程。
所有人看著電腦屏幕上顯示的跟蹤信息,眼睛瞪得像榴蓮那麽大。
***,這也太生猛了啊!沒見過“磁芯大戰”還可以這麽玩的!
進程分配完畢,蕭雲飛的程序出現在了進程隊列中,而羅傑斯教授的程序卻根本就沒有在進程隊列中出現!
此時,海闊憑魚躍,天高任鳥飛。
蕭雲飛的程序就像橫著走的螃蟹,在內存單元中跳來跳去,隔一會還要生成一個副本程序,不到兩分鍾,所有的內存單元都被繁衍出來的副本占領了。
蕭雲飛看著羅傑斯教授猥瑣的笑了笑:“教授,你輸了哦……”
所有人激動的向蕭雲飛鼓掌慶賀,田中仲才更是一臉崇拜的看著蕭雲飛。
羅傑斯教授拍了拍腦袋,心服口服地歎了一口氣。
蕭雲飛的聲音並不響亮,但是卻透著一種自信和堅定。
圍觀的學生看到說話的蕭雲飛,紛紛替他讓出一條道,心中暗自竊喜,剛才羅傑斯教授的眼神和語氣令他們這些天之驕子無地自容,此時看到又有人出來挑戰,他們自然對蕭雲飛表現出了極大的熱情。
羅傑斯看著蕭雲飛笑了笑:“小夥子,你確定要挑戰我的擂台?”
蕭雲飛看著羅傑斯教授藍色的眼睛,堅定的點了點頭。
羅傑斯聳了聳肩攤開雙手:“好吧,你的精神令我很佩服,不過我希望你設計出來的程序能夠健壯一點,不然這個遊戲就不好玩了。”
蕭雲飛笑了笑沒有說話,徑直走到一台計算機麵前坐了下來,然後,他開始編寫程序了。
蕭雲飛編寫程序的速度很快,雙手好像在鍵盤上舞蹈一樣,動作行雲流水,中間根本就沒有一絲停頓的跡象,因為在觀戰的時候,蕭雲飛針對羅傑斯教授的程序在內存單元中的表現,已經在腦海中的設計好了每一條程序指令。
薛亞妮看著蕭雲飛一臉專注的表情,臉上不由得閃過一絲好奇的笑意,看他編寫程序的樣子,似乎真的不簡單呢。
蕭雲飛在程序中采用了“混沌加密”加密了一段關於對某一特定模塊集中轟炸的指令,同時,程序中還加密**了一個中斷程序。
國際上地加密算法多種多樣。一個人不可能對每種加密算法都了如指掌。所以蕭雲飛運用“混沌加密”地算法加密匯編程序。其他人也並未覺得奇怪。
蕭雲飛用了五分鍾就編好了這個程序。然後他站起身衝羅傑斯教授說道:“教授。我地程序已經編寫好了。我們可以開始比賽了嗎?”
羅傑斯看了看蕭雲飛。有點擔憂地問道:“小夥子。你不再檢查檢查?雖然我地擂台是一個遊戲。但是我也不希望你如此輕視對待。”
蕭雲飛擺了擺手:“教授。正是因為我重視他。所以我才用最精短地程序來向您挑戰。”
蕭雲飛頓了頓接著說道:“程序地作戰能力並不取決代碼數量地多少。它在於自保、攻擊和修複地能力。這些東西完全是從算法地層麵上考慮。我地程序。相信已經把這些功能揮得淋漓盡致了。”
羅傑斯教授“哼”了一聲。似乎很不滿意蕭雲飛地說辭。他覺得蕭雲飛就是在輕視他。
“你的程序再好,能敵得過我的智能程序?”羅傑斯教授恨恨的問道。
蕭雲飛笑了笑:“或許您地程序根本就揮不了作用呢。”
羅傑斯教授差點被蕭雲飛氣死:“啊!待會我一定要打得你這個狂妄的小子滿地找牙!”
“既然這樣,那我們何不馬上開始呢?”
“好!我要讓你見識見識我的厲害。”羅傑斯教授有點孩子氣的坐到計算機前,衝蕭雲飛如是說道。
兩個人地程序先被保存在虛擬係統的存儲磁芯,然後程序開始加載,就在係統要給程序在進程隊列中創建進程地時候,蕭雲飛的中斷程序被觸,然後中斷程序開始運行。
這個中斷程序的作用就是禁止係統創建進程,無法創建進程,羅傑斯教授的程序就根本不能進行內存遍曆,連內存遍曆都不能進行,如何對蕭雲飛的程序進行轟炸?
打個比方,如果秦始皇在朱姬肚子裏的時候就被幹掉了,縱然他有刀槍不入,水火不侵,三頭六臂,神功蓋世,英武不凡,氣宇軒昂,人見人愛,花見花開,車胎見了要爆胎地本事,他也不可能一統六國,成為天下霸主。
當然,我們要排除《尋秦記》中找人冒充嬴政的橋段。
(pss:形容詞我本來打算還多用幾個地,但是我怕各位讀大大打我的臉,所以還是算了,畢竟我是靠臉混飯吃滴……)
所以,蕭雲飛地目的就是要把羅傑斯地程序扼殺在搖籃裏,不給它機會跳出存儲磁芯!
羅傑斯教授望了望計算機屏幕,然後側過頭來看著蕭雲飛問道:“你動了什麽手腳?為什麽係統沒有為我們兩人的程序分配進程?”
“嗬嗬,”蕭雲飛撓了撓頭不好意思的笑了笑,“教授,你的程序這麽厲害,我當然不能讓它進入到內存單元中去,所以我的中斷程序將係統創建進程的功能鎖定了。”
“啊?”羅傑斯教授的眼睛瞪得老大,“我們的程序對戰,你就應該讓它們跳進內存單元轟轟烈烈的廝殺一番,想不到你竟然用這一招!”
“可是教授,您並沒有規定隻能進行程序間的對抗啊,我當然可以另辟蹊徑。”蕭雲飛有點無辜的攤開雙手。
試想,如果你要正麵入侵一個指
站,而這個網站的安保性能非常強大,你會怎麽做?
相信很多人都會采用旁注這種辦法。先,入侵這個網站服務器下其他安全性較為薄弱的網站;然後,通過這個被入侵的網站想辦法得到服務器的控製權限;最後,利用服務器的控製權限黑掉這個指定的網站。
這個步驟被人戲稱為“黑站三部曲”。
蕭雲飛的辦法其實與“旁注”有異曲同工之妙,為什麽這麽說?他並沒有從羅傑斯的程序上入手,相反,他采用的是從程序運行的係統上下手,讓程序喪失運行的條件。
黑客,要具有散的思維,可不能一條道走到底啊!
羅傑斯被蕭雲飛說得啞口無言,其他圍觀也露出若有所思的表情。
“小夥子,既然你禁止了係統分配進程,那麽我們兩人的程序都不能進入到內存單元,所以,進程隊列中不會出現我的程序,但是同樣也不會出現你的程序,我們也算是個平局,你也並沒有打擂成功哦……”羅傑斯教授看著蕭雲飛,臉上帶著狡猾的笑意。
蕭雲飛笑了笑,露出一副果然如此的表情:“我早知道教授您會這麽說,不過別著急,好戲還在後頭呢。”
係統分配進程的功能雖然被中斷程序禁用了,這就相當於程序被掛起,根本就不可能執行,但是蕭雲飛的模塊集中轟炸指令卻並未受到束縛,在羅傑斯教授和蕭雲飛交談的過程中,它已經尋找到了固定在存儲磁芯的程序。
係統不能為程序分配進程,但是程序此時依然是保存在係統的存儲磁芯中的,雖然這個存儲磁芯的地址是一個範圍,但是這個範圍是不會改變的。
蕭雲飛的模塊集中轟炸指令的功能就是針對這個固定範圍的存儲磁芯地址進行地毯式轟炸!
羅傑斯看到自己的程序在存儲磁芯中被蕭雲飛的程序轟炸,臉上露出一副不可置信的表情,周圍的學生更是一片嘩然。
到目前為止,根本就沒有人見過能夠在存儲磁芯中進行轟炸功能的程序!
羅傑斯教授的程序雖然具有一定的智能性,但是這種智能性要取決於它生存的環境,比如在內存單元中,他的程序可不是那麽容易被幹掉的。
但是現在的情況不一樣,羅傑斯教授的程序在存儲磁芯中就像被施了定身咒,麵對模塊集中轟炸指令,它根本就沒有一點反應。
可憐這個帶有一定智能性的程序就被當成靶子被轟炸得屍骨無存了。
轟炸指令完成它的使命後自動執行了一條毀滅自己的指令,這個指令和大名鼎鼎的“收割”(reaper)程序的自毀指令是一樣的。
(pss:“收割”程序就是對“爬行”程序進行攻擊,其實田中仲才的程序裂變與“爬行”的行為很類似,通過瘋狂繁衍副本來擠掉電腦中的原有資料,“收割”的目的就是要毀滅掉這些副本)
這些自毀指令通常都是有目的性的,比如“收割”程序的自毀是為了還原電腦幹淨的空間,蕭雲飛的程序轟炸指令的自毀,目的就是向程序本體傳遞一個信息。
董存瑞炸碉堡時候喊的口號是:“同誌們,為了新中國,衝啊!”
轟炸指令的自毀,傳遞的信息其實和英雄的意思差不多,那就是在告訴程序本體:“哥們,我已經把敵人消滅了,臨死之前我放了信號彈,後麵的打、砸、搶、燒等暴力活動就交給你們啦……”
董存瑞的戰友們聽到這句鼓舞人心的話,吹著激昂的衝鋒號,雄赳氣昂昂,順利地攻占了敵人的堡壘。
程序收到轟炸指令的自毀信息,立馬解除了中斷程序,係統分配進程的禁令解除,然後開始為蕭雲飛的程序分配進程。
所有人看著電腦屏幕上顯示的跟蹤信息,眼睛瞪得像榴蓮那麽大。
***,這也太生猛了啊!沒見過“磁芯大戰”還可以這麽玩的!
進程分配完畢,蕭雲飛的程序出現在了進程隊列中,而羅傑斯教授的程序卻根本就沒有在進程隊列中出現!
此時,海闊憑魚躍,天高任鳥飛。
蕭雲飛的程序就像橫著走的螃蟹,在內存單元中跳來跳去,隔一會還要生成一個副本程序,不到兩分鍾,所有的內存單元都被繁衍出來的副本占領了。
蕭雲飛看著羅傑斯教授猥瑣的笑了笑:“教授,你輸了哦……”
所有人激動的向蕭雲飛鼓掌慶賀,田中仲才更是一臉崇拜的看著蕭雲飛。
羅傑斯教授拍了拍腦袋,心服口服地歎了一口氣。